Priscilla Alsip, 90, died March 16, at Messenger House on Bainbridge Island, where she had resided for the past two years. She was born Priscilla Eleanor Magill, dau of Judge Francis A. Magill and Jeannie (Young) Magill. She married John F. Alsip, Jr. in 1936 and they moved to Nampa, Idaho, where the couple owned and operated the Alsip Funeral Chapel for over 30 years. She was preceded in death by her husband John Alsip, who died in 1986. She is survived by two sons, John F. Alsip and wife Kay of Excelsior, Minn, and Bruce F. Alsip and wife Vicki of Seattle; daughter Priscilla N. Lange and husband Edward of Bainbridge Island; seven grandchildren and four (soon to be five) great grandchildren.
